Immunochemical analyses of estrogen receptors in human breast tumors by a novel monoclonal estrogen receptor antibody (EVG F9)

摘要
The objective of this study was to assess the potential utility of a new site-directed, monoclonal anti-estrogen receptor antibody (EVG F9) in detection and analyses of human breast tumor estrogen receptor (ER alpha), using immunoblotting and immunohistochemical assays. Using Western Blot analyses, we demonstrated that EVG F9 monoclonal antibody binds specifically to ER alpha and does not cross-react with ER beta. Furthermore, binding of EVG F9 to ER alpha was effectively displaced with the immunogenic peptide in Western Blots and in immunohistochemical analyses. In Western Blot analyses, EVG F9 detected ER alpha at low concentrations approaching 5 to 10 fmol/sample. Determination of ER alpha status of a series of human breast tumor samples by Western Blot analyses or immunohistochemistry using EVG F9 correlated well with ER alpha values measured by ligand binding assays. These observations suggest that EVG F9 monoclonal anti-ER alpha antibody is a valuable immunochemical tool for detection and analyses of ER alpha in human breast tumors.
